@TreborTheTall in his video (Imperial world, medium, 6 players AI difficulty on Extreme, world threat at Hardcore, Random landmass) I thought that the biggest challenge would be resource income so I took a Celestian Dvar. Dvar because they can run around prospecting (extra production) and celestian because I wanted the Karmic Amplification (more Quests and fewer Demands) which also ends up with more rewards and also more influence which i thought would be important to stop at least a few players form declaring war on me.
Well at least some parts there didn't work out - Everybody declared war on me despite my efforts, guess that is what happens if you play on extreme and are by far the weakest player on the field with only one city

I also really ran into trouble with research, I relied heavily on clearing anomaly sites for this and everything went fine until I cleared my large anomaly site, afterwards there were not so many anomaly sites left and they were spread far, so basically I was stuck in lategame with a research of 50-90 which is absolutely not enough to get much done and I was severly outclassed by the AI in terms of operation strength, i ran secret state to be somewhat on par with my operational defense, but the plan to use the influence from quests for research taps and energy siphons didn't work for the most part. At the very end game I couldn't even target the opponents anymore because the success chance was too low and despite nearly constant internal purges there were often some breaches remaining.
On the plus side energy and production were not a problem, I also was extremely lucky with the dwellings, I had the Autonom and the Spacers and the Wasteland scavengers (extra gold from killed units) and factory overseers (extra production and happiness in the colony) as well as the self-repair system mod on the dvar mechanical units really helped a lot!
Also there were plenty of wars between the AI and because I only had one city most AIs decided to attack their AI neighbour they shared borders with, so even though everybody was at war with me I only really had to fight back my two immediate neighbours (an Assembly and another Dvar) and luckily the Assembly leader was the first to be taken out by Aya Sashimoto (Vanguard AI)

.
A bit later the Kir'Ko leader on the other side of the map was killed by Aya. But this killer Vanguard had suffered heavy losses in the process. I was in the vicinity anyways carefully sneaking around looking for anomalies to fuel my research but seeing a golden opportunity went for Ms. Sahimotos capital instead while she was in the void and took it with comparably little resistance (only one double stack and one doublestack+militia in the capital).
The rest was easy because only one Vanguard (Leyla) and another Dvar (Jewal Gruvich) remained and were at each others throat leaving me in peace for the most part. I sent my mobile anomaly stacks lurking around and razing cities of the Vanguard player while I pumped up my defense army to have a bit more offensive power and slowly started moving towards the Dvar with three stacks that included some Rocket Artillery. My fast stacks were waiting for a big fight between the Dvar and the Vanguard again and when that happened I could go for the kill again taking out the last remaining vanguard leader.
It was not really planned that way, but it was a great luck that I fought the Dvar leader last, because I had done pretty much nothing to make Dvar happy during the entire game (no founding cities obviously and was at war with another dvar) and they turned to outright hostile now that I started to burn down dvar cities (because what else is left If you want to play with only one colony...) they outright hated me and if the game would have dragged on much longer some might have even deserted. So that was lucky coincidence that I waited until the last moment to actively fight the Dvar leader and was Celestian so I could give my units at least the "enlightened" morale modifier...
